2012-07 Columbus, OH – Senior Project Engineer
Position Requirements: Status: Full-time Schedule/Hours: 40 hours/week Location: Columbus, OH Travel: 30% - 40%
Position Summary: Responsible for overall design engineering, coordinating & managing engineering services and ensuring they are completed on time and on budget.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Full responsibility for interpreting, organizing, executing and coordinating assignments Performs engineering duties in planning, designing, and overseeing construction and maintenance of building structures and facilities such as roads, channels, dams, irrigation projects, pipelines, power plants, water and sewage systems, and waste disposal units Analysis of survey reports, maps, and drawings, aerial and other topographical or geologic data; computing load and grade requirements, water flow rates, and material stress factors; and conduct studies of environmental conditions Demonstrates a high degree of creativity, foresight, and judgment in anticipation and solving engineering complexities Applies intensive and diversified knowledge of engineering principles and practices Responsible for time and budget analysis and making sure project is on time and budget Provides schematic design information Prepares preliminary task lists Providing technical engineering information to project management to ensure that work complies with customer specifications & engineering standards Makes independent decisions on engineering problems and methods
Knowledge/Skill/Ability Requirements: Minimum of Bachelor's degree in engineering or related science with 5-7 years leadership experience; or equivalent combination of education and experience Registered Professional Engineer preferred for engineering project managers PE License Working knowledge of AutoCAD or similar software; 3D Civil software experience desired
